Today’s recipe is ‘Sooji Dry Fruit Ladoo’. It is an easy dessert recipe, which is good for health. These ladoos helps in improving immunity during the winter season. It can be enjoyed as a mini snack, you can also pack one ladoo in your kid’s lunch box. It is a good way to introduce dry fruits in your and family’s diet.

For this ladoo recipe, you will need – semolina/sooji, dry grated coconut/desiccated coconut, cashew nuts, raisins, edible gum, ghee, sugar, and cardamom powder. There is one more version of this recipe, in which sugar syrup is used in the recipe. To reduce the difficulty level and preparation time of the recipe, I am using powdered sugar instead of sugar syrup.

Yield: 18-20
Duration: 40 mins
Ingredients for Sooji Dry Fruit Ladoo
Sooji/semolina | 1 cup |
Desiccated coconut | 1/2 cup |
Ghee | 1/4 cup |
Sugar (powdered) | 1/2 cup or as per taste |
Milk | 2-3Tbsp or as required for preparing ladoo |
Cashew nuts (in two halves) | 2 Tbsp |
Raisin | 1 Tbsp |
Edible gum/ gond | 1.5 Tbsp |
Cardamom powder | 1/2 tsp |
Method for Sooji Dry Fruit Ladoo
- In a deep vessel, heat ghee.
- Start frying cashew nuts first, till they turn golden in colour and keep it aside.
- Fry raisin, till it puffs. Keep it aside.
- In the same ghee, add semolina/sooji and roast till start fragrant and turns light brown in colour.
- Add desiccated coconut and roast for 2-3 mins.
- Next, add powdered sugar and cardamom powder. Cook for 3-4 mins. Switch off the flame.
- Remove the mixture to a plate.
- In the same vessel, add 1/2 tsp ghee.Start frying edible gum, till it puffs. Keep it aside.
- Add puffed edible gum/ gond to the ladoo mix.
- Now, in small batches start adding warm milk, to the mix. Add till you get a mixture of binding consistency, which is perfect for ladoo preparation.
- Start preparing ladoos from the mixture.
- Serve immediately or store in the fridge.
